Hi Guys, bit of a weird title i know but i have a wonky (passenger side) Xenon, please see below. Anyone come across this before? Is it a sealed unit? Can it be fixed?

Also I have a really weird series of what look like tiny brittle hairline cracks in in my headlight glass on both xenons.

I thought it would polish out. I'll try to get a good photo soon but you can see it in the second photo. It Makes the lovely clear glass look yellow and blurred, almost like its gone dried out and brittle in the sun... :?

Put simply, its caput.

Same happened to mine, and I had to buy two brand new headlights as they were both ruined

They are £160-£200 each depending on where you get them from, so be warned

It sucks, but thats normally the result of a front end shunt when the reflector has dropped that far.

tegwin wrote:Alex, can they not be dissasembled and "repaired" or at the very least straightened out a bit?
They could be, but repairing the adjusters on the xenon units is impossible, and the parts are different to the normal headlights.

Plus once they have been popped, they will never seal properly and will likely condensate often.
